当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储分布式存储区别与联系,对象存储与分布式存储,技术解析、区别与联系

对象存储分布式存储区别与联系,对象存储与分布式存储,技术解析、区别与联系

对象存储与分布式存储是两种不同类型的存储技术。对象存储以对象为单位存储数据,具有高扩展性和可伸缩性;分布式存储则通过多个节点分散存储数据,实现高可用性和容错性。两者在架...

对象存储与分布式存储是两种不同类型的存储技术。对象存储以对象为单位存储数据,具有高扩展性和可伸缩性;分布式存储则通过多个节点分散存储数据,实现高可用性和容错性。两者在架构、性能、适用场景等方面存在差异,但都旨在提高数据存储的效率和可靠性。

随着互联网的飞速发展,数据量呈爆炸式增长,对存储技术提出了更高的要求,对象存储和分布式存储作为当前主流的存储技术,各自具有独特的优势,本文将从技术原理、应用场景、性能特点等方面,深入解析对象存储与分布式存储的区别与联系。

对象存储与分布式存储技术原理

1、对象存储

对象存储是一种基于对象的存储技术,将数据以对象的形式存储,每个对象包含数据、元数据和访问控制信息,对象存储系统通常采用RESTful API进行数据访问,支持大规模数据存储和高效的数据检索。

2、分布式存储

对象存储分布式存储区别与联系,对象存储与分布式存储,技术解析、区别与联系

分布式存储是一种将数据分散存储在多个节点上的存储技术,通过数据分片、负载均衡、冗余备份等手段,提高存储系统的可靠性和性能,分布式存储系统通常采用一致性哈希、Gossip协议等算法实现数据一致性。

对象存储与分布式存储应用场景

1、对象存储应用场景

(1)海量数据存储:对象存储适用于大规模数据存储,如云盘、视频网站、图片存储等。

(2)数据归档:对象存储可以方便地实现数据的长期存储和归档。

(3)数据共享:对象存储支持跨地域、跨平台的数据共享。

2、分布式存储应用场景

(1)高性能计算:分布式存储适用于高性能计算场景,如大数据处理、人工智能训练等。

(2)分布式数据库:分布式存储可以作为分布式数据库的后端存储,提高数据库的扩展性和性能。

(3)云服务:分布式存储在云计算领域具有广泛应用,如云存储、云数据库等。

对象存储分布式存储区别与联系,对象存储与分布式存储,技术解析、区别与联系

对象存储与分布式存储性能特点

1、对象存储性能特点

(1)高吞吐量:对象存储系统通常具有高吞吐量,适用于大规模数据访问。

(2)高可靠性:对象存储系统采用冗余备份、数据校验等技术,保证数据可靠性。

(3)易扩展性:对象存储系统支持在线扩展,方便应对数据量增长。

2、分布式存储性能特点

(1)高性能:分布式存储通过数据分片、负载均衡等技术,提高存储系统的性能。

(2)高可靠性:分布式存储系统采用数据冗余、故障转移等技术,保证数据可靠性。

(3)强一致性:分布式存储系统通过一致性算法,保证数据一致性。

对象存储与分布式存储区别与联系

1、区别

对象存储分布式存储区别与联系,对象存储与分布式存储,技术解析、区别与联系

(1)数据模型:对象存储以对象为单位存储数据,分布式存储以数据块为单位存储数据。

(2)数据访问:对象存储采用RESTful API进行数据访问,分布式存储通常采用专有的API或协议。

(3)性能特点:对象存储适用于大规模数据访问,分布式存储适用于高性能计算场景。

2、联系

(1)技术基础:对象存储和分布式存储都基于分布式存储技术,如数据分片、负载均衡等。

(2)应用场景:对象存储和分布式存储在应用场景上具有一定的重叠,如云存储、大数据处理等。

(3)发展趋势:随着技术的不断发展,对象存储和分布式存储将相互融合,形成更加完善的存储体系。

对象存储与分布式存储作为当前主流的存储技术,在数据存储领域具有广泛的应用,通过对两者技术原理、应用场景、性能特点等方面的分析,可以发现它们既有区别又有联系,随着技术的不断发展,对象存储和分布式存储将相互融合,为数据存储领域带来更多可能性。

黑狐家游戏

发表评论

最新文章